libstdc++: Remove workaround for FE bug in std::tuple [PR96592]
The FE bug was fixed, so we don't need this workaround now.
libstdc++-v3/ChangeLog:
PR libstdc++/96592
* include/std/tuple (tuple::is_constructible): Remove.
(cherry picked from commit 76c6be48b7841524974754f8ea7533b82c7de77e)
